Maybe make a little frame and attach some wire from an old window screen or some light (not to dense) shade cloth. In our area snails and slugs are worst offenders, then the birds when they are really ripe. We had trouble with ants one year. They made tiny little holes in them and ate the centre of the strawberries first. We soon learnt that you didn’t pick one off the plant and put it straight in our mouths.
I don’t mind sharing ours with our resident blue tongue. But if it’s become a problem, put wire around your garden, the small hole one. That would stop blue tongues. If you’re talking skinks……I have no idea
